I poked at this on an off all day hoping to get it into the RC, but I think it needs more eyes now. I've refactored it a fair bit to make it simpler and more consistent. Here is the branch:

Please see the new commit for the list of changes. Also note, it probably makes more sense if you diff the whole branch now against master (or HEAD^^) rather than looking at the commits separately.

Finally, I noticed that the colors in this branch are different than current XUL, using orange for overdues, then red for long overdue, then dark red for lost. I did not make that change, but found it very sensible, so I left it that way. I know there is an argument to be made for keeping it the same as the old client, but there is also one to made for this sort of logical progression of "reddening". If we are going to make the change, now is the time, so I left it, but it wouldn't be hard to swap them around.
